以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 合并数据,日期时间列 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=126527) |
-- 作者:fubblyc -- 发布时间:2018/10/23 15:27:00 -- 合并数据,日期时间列 老师,代码是这样: Dim t As Table = Tables("pos刷卡明细导入2") t.StopRedraw() For Each fl As String In dlg.FileNames Dim Book As New XLS.Book(fl) Dim Sheet As XLS.Sheet = Book.Sheets(0) For n As Integer = 4 To Sheet.Rows.Count-2 Dim r As Row = t.AddNew() For i As Integer = 0 To sheet.Cols.Count - 2 Dim cname As String = sheet(3, i).text If t.Cols.Contains(cname) Then Dim s As String = sheet(n, i).Text r(cname) = s output.show(s) End If Next Next Next t.ResumeRedraw() 进入的日期时间列只有日期,我已经把列属性改为日期时间了,不知道什么原因。。。 此主题相关图片如下:微信截图_20181023152532.png [此贴子已经被作者于2018/10/23 15:27:42编辑过]
|
-- 作者:有点甜 -- 发布时间:2018/10/23 16:16:00 -- 这个是bug,要额外处理
http://foxtable.com/bbs/dispbbs.asp?BoardID=2&ID=65686&skin=0
|